TheTrusteeship Councilwas established in 1945 by the UN Charter, underChapter XIII, to provide international supervision for 11 Trust Territories that had been placed under the administration of seven Member States, and ensure that adequate steps were taken to prepare the Territories for self-government and independence. Since 1948, the UN has helped end conflicts and foster reconciliation by conducting successful peacekeeping operations in dozens of countries, including Cambodia, El Salvador, Guatemala, Mozambique, Namibia and Tajikistan. The Secretary-General is Chief Administrative Officerof the Organization, appointed by the General Assembly on the recommendation of the Security Council for a five-year, renewable term. Print; Share; Edit; Delete; Report an issue; Live modes. The practice of convening high-level thematic debates is also a direct outcome of the revitalization process. This was first identified as a priority during the 58th session, and efforts continued at subsequent sessions to streamline the agenda, improve the practices and working methods of the Main Committees, enhance the role of the General Committee, strengthen the role and authority of the President and examine the Assemblys role in the process of selecting the Secretary-General. The Assembly meets from September to December each year (main part), and thereafter, from January to September (resumed part), as required, including to take up outstanding reports from the Fourth and Fifth Committees. What did the United Nations do in the Cold War? - Studybuff The main bodies of the United Nationsare the General Assembly, the Security Council, the Economic and Social Council, the Trusteeship Council, the International Court of Justice, and the UN Secretariat. Each year, in September, the full UN membership meets in the General Assembly Hall in New York for the annual General Assembly session, andgeneral debate, which many heads of state attend and address. The original Members of the United Nations shall be the states which, having participated in the United Nations Conference on International Organization at San Francisco, or having previously signed the Declaration by United Nations of 1 January 1942, sign the present Charter and ratify it in accordance with Article 110. TheEconomic and Social Councilis the principal body for coordination, policy review, policy dialogue and recommendations on economic, social and environmental issues, as well as implementation of internationally agreed development goals.
